1 part balsamic or white wine vinegar to three parts oil, a dash of lemon juice, some english mustard and a pinch of sugar, salt and pepper.

This is basically what my mum has taught me, and it goes well with nearly any kind of salad. SHe's Italian/Spanish, so any kind of food advice she gives me a make a mental note of.
